At UVa, ‘The Green Bird‘ is ruffling some feathers for fun – The Daily Progress

With about 40% of the University of Virginia Department of Drama’s new show being improvised, it’s safe to say that the cast of “The Green Bird” …

Read More at Source.

Pumilo
Author: Pumilo